Here’s the Full Breakdown
- Harry Potter and the Philosopher’s Stone (2001) – The magical journey begins.
-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ets (2002) – Darker mysteries unfold.
-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azkaban (2004) – A deeper exploration of danger and friendship.
-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ire (2005) – The entry into the chaotic tournaments.
-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ix (2007) – Growing tensions rise.
-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ince (2009) – Dumbledore’s secrets and Voldemort’s return.
-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ows – Part 1 (2010) – The start of the final battle.
-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ows – Part 2 (2011) – The legendary conclusion.
This makes a total of eight films in the main cinematic universe.
